The HEDS-9700#H51 belongs to the category of optical encoders.
It is used for converting mechanical motion into electronic signals.

The HEDS-9700#H51 features the following pin configuration: 1. Vcc 2. Channel A 3. Channel B 4. Index 5. Ground
The HEDS-9700#H51 operates on the principle of optical encoding, where a light source and photodetectors are used to detect and convert mechanical motion into digital signals.
The HEDS-9700#H51 finds applications in various fields including: - Robotics - CNC machinery - Industrial automation - Medical equipment
